This was in the NY Times article which announced Spongebob taking the Palace:

"The show will open at the Palace before construction begins on a major renovation that is years in the making and would involve lifting the theater 29 feet to make room for retail space on Times Square. The Nederlander Organization, which owns the theater, said that because the project was still in development, the Palace was available to book “SpongeBob.”"

I usher for the company that owns the Palace. I wouldn't be shocked at all for this renovation project to end up not happening. Keep in mind, it was initially scheduled to start when American in Paris closed. The Illusionists came into town for a holiday run with them saying that it was gonna start after that show was done. Same with Sunset. This is, to me at least, starting to sound like the time they announced a big touristy 4D history of Broadway thing at the Times Square theatre, kept saying it was gonna happen and never did
